Summary

The increasing development of apps for digital devices provides anopportunity for new instruments to assess hallucinations in youngindividuals. Here we present the Multisensory HAllucinations Scale forChildren (MHASC), dedicated to assessing complex early-onset hallucinations.The MHASC will soon be translated into multilanguage versions with thesupport of the International Consortium of Hallucination Research.

Fig. 1 The modular architecture of the MHASC© app.Two levels of navigation are provided: one dedicated to professionals (upper panel) and the other dedicated to children and adolescents (lower panel). Future developments will allow the addition of new modules to these two dashboards (for example an ecological momentary assessment module (EMA)…).
